What does a scanning clerk do?

A Scanning Clerk is responsible for digitizing paper documents by scanning them into electronic formats. They organize, prepare, and feed documents into scanning machines, ensuring that images are clear and legible. Scanning Clerks also verify scanned files for accuracy, categorize them in digital filing systems, and may handle sensitive or confidential information. Their work helps organizations transition to paperless systems and improves document accessibility and storage efficiency.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a scanning clerk,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Scanning Clerk, you need attention to detail, organizational skills, and basic computer literacy, often with a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with document management systems, scanners, and office software like Microsoft Office is typically required. Strong time management, reliability, and effective communication help in handling large volumes of sensitive documents efficiently. These skills are crucial to ensure accurate digital record-keeping and maintain the integrity and accessibility of important information.

What are some common challenges faced by scanning clerks, and how can they be effectively managed?

Scanning Clerks often encounter challenges such as handling high volumes of documents, maintaining accuracy during digitization, and ensuring sensitive information is managed securely. Staying organized, following well-defined procedures, and double-checking scanned files help minimize errors. Additionally, familiarity with scanning software and regular communication with team members can streamline workflow and address any technical issues promptly.

What is the difference between Scanning Clerk vs Data Entry Clerk?

AspectScanning ClerkData Entry Clerk
Primary RoleScanning and digitizing physical documentsInputting data into computer systems
Required SkillsAttention to detail, familiarity with scannersTyping speed, accuracy, software proficiency
Work EnvironmentOffice, data centers, archivesOffice, remote options
Common CertificationsNone required, but familiarity with document management systems helpsTyping certifications, data management courses

While both roles involve handling information, a Scanning Clerk focuses on digitizing physical documents through scanning, whereas a Data Entry Clerk specializes in inputting data into digital systems. Both roles require attention to detail and are essential in data management workflows, often working in office environments.
